In this work, rectangular vanadium pentoxide (V2O5) microrods were synthesized by the facile chemical route. For the crystal structure and morphology of the obtained microstructures, the material was characterized by X-ray diffraction (XRD), Scanning Electron Microscopy (SEM), Transmission Electron Microscopy (TEM). The elemental composition spectra and elemental mapping of the V2O5 were studied by EDAX measurement. The results showed the successful synthesis of pure and crystalline orthorhombic phase of V2O5 rectangular microrods with appropriate elemental compositions. @& nbsp;2021 Elsevier Ltd.
